The theme for the 27th Annual Sarasota Holiday Parade taking place on Saturday, December 2, 2023 is Holidays Around The World. We anticipate registration opening on July 1, 2023. Before registering, Please read the How To Enter page and send any and all questions to admin@sarasotaholidayparade.com.

Parade Winners 2022!
BEST IN SHOW: Stage Door Studios
Best Winter Wonderland Theme: Circus Arts Conservatory
Best Commercial Entry: Longboat Key Builders
Honorable Mention: SeaSucker
Best Nonprofit Entry: Big Cat Habitat
Best Performance: Platinum Superstars Dance Factory
Best Walking Group: The Dark Side
Best School Entry: Foundations Christian Montessori Academy
Honorable Mention: Sarasota School of Arts and Sciences (SSAS)
Best Church: Sarasota Baptist Church
Judges’ Choice: Project Pride SRQ
Street Closures 2022

The 26th Anniversary of the Sarasota Holiday Parade will be held on Saturday, Dec. 3, 2022 at 7 p.m. The parade will begin at Main Street and U.S. 301 in downtown Sarasota. The parade will end at J.D. Hamel Park at Main Street and Gulfstream Avenue.
There will be multiple street closure notices and vehicle tow-away zones in effect for the following times and locations:
- 9 a.m. Saturday to 12:30 a.m. Sunday: Main Street closed from Osprey to US 301
- 9 a.m. Saturday to 12:30 a.m. Sunday: Main Street closed from Orange Avenue to Osprey Avenue
- 11 a.m. Saturday – 12:30 a.m. Sunday: Main Street closed from US 41 to Orange Avenue
- 12 p.m. Saturday – 12:30 a.m. Sunday: Main Street closed from U.S. 301 to School Avenue
- 12 p.m. Saturday – 12:30 a.m. Sunday: Fletcher Avenue closed from Main Street to Fruitville
- 12 p.m. Saturday – 12:30 a.m. Sunday: Wallace closed from Main Street to Fruitville
- 12 p.m. Saturday – 12:30 a.m. Sunday: East Avenue closed from Fruitville to Ringling Boulevard
- 12 p.m. Saturday – 12:30 a.m. Sunday: School Avenue closed from Main Street to Fruitville
- 12 p.m. Saturday – 12:30 a.m. Sunday: Audubon closed from Main Street to Fruitville
- 12 p.m. Saturday – 12:30 a.m. Sunday: First Street closed from Audubon to East Avenue
- 2:30 p.m. Saturday – 12:30 a.m. Sunday: Lemon Avenue closed from First Street to Main Street
- 3 p.m. Saturday – 12:30 a.m. Sunday: Gulfstream Avenue closed from US 41 to McAnsh
- 7 p.m.: Sarasota Holiday Parade begins
Roads will re-open once the end of the parade reaches a two-block distance from each road closure. Vehicles not removed by the posted time will be towed at the owner’s expense. For information on towed vehicles, contact Upman’s Towing at 941-365-7084.
